Information We Collect Directly From Job Seekers

You do not have to provide us with any personal information to view our Site, and you are permitted to browse job postings anonymously. If you wish to apply for a LINK Staffing position, you will be required to register with LINK Staffing through our Site at www.linkstaffing.com and submit, at minimum, your first and last name, social security number, email address, how you heard of LINK Staffing, and select the LINK Staffing office closest to you. We may collect information from you at different phases of the employment process; in other words, you may submit certain limited information when you register with us, and if hired, you may need to submit additional information. The following are examples of information that we may collect directly from you through your voluntary submission: First, middle and/or last name, email address, postal address, date of birth, phone number(s), social security number; employment history, educational history, or any other information that you choose to submit to us; and information that may be contained in a resume that you choose to voluntarily submit to us. Once information is electronically entered, you are unable to change some information through this Site. You will be able to provide updates in person at a LINK Staffing office. When you register, we use your information for the purpose of fulfilling your job application with LINK Staffing. We may share your information with third parties to process your application or to conduct a background check. We will not conduct a background check without notifying you and first obtaining your specific consent. If you choose not to provide certain information, however, then we may be unable to provide you with all of the features of our online product.

Sharing Your Information

Job Seekers: We share job seeker information, at your request and direction, with our clients. We also share job seeker information, after you have consented, to third parties for the purposes, as applicable, of conducting background checks and to determine whether your employment would be eligible for generating tax credits for us. After an applicant is hired, we also may share additional information with clients for payroll or other administrative functions.

All Personal Information (Job Seekers, Employers, and Other Site Visitors): We may hire vendor companies to provide limited services on our behalf, such as payment processing, sending postal and electronic mail, providing technical support, and to assist us in providing the products and services that you request from us. We only provide those service providers with the information necessary to perform the requested service.

We also may engage in joint marketing activities with third parties. If we do so, then we give you an opportunity to opt out of such information sharing.

We do not sell, lease, or rent your personal information to other companies or individuals.  LINK Staffing, however, reserves the right to disclose your information if it licenses, sells, or otherwise transfers its technology or business, or a portion thereof, to third parties, including, but not limited to, mergers, acquisitions, and bankruptcy proceedings.

We also may disclose your information to protect our rights and property, to prevent against fraud and abuse, and to protect other users of our services. We also may disclose your information as permitted or required by law.
